Studded Buffalo Burgers
Total Time: 30 mins
Preparation Time: 15 mins
Cook Time: 15 mins
Ingredients
- Servings: 4
- 1 lb ground buffalo meat
- 4 ounces chorizo sausage
- 1 teaspoon olive oil
- 2 tablespoons minced onions
- 1 tablespoon minced scallion
- 1 tablespoon minced bell pepper
- 1/4 cup seasoned bread crumbs
- 1 egg
- 1 tablespoon ketchup
- 1/4 cup corn kernel, defrosted if frozen
- 1 chipotle chile in adobo, seeded if desired and minced
Recipe
- 1 mince chorizo and pre cook for minutes. heat olive oil over medium heat.
- 2 cook chorizo in oil with onions, and pepper. saute mixture till veggies are lightly softened and chorizo released some of the fat. mix in bread crumbs . set aside to cool. i place it in the freezer for quickness or can be made early in the day or the day before. :).
- 3 in a bowl add egg, ketchup, corn, chipotle pepper and cooled chorizo mixture. add the ground beef and mix to blend ingredients.make 4 patties placing a hole in the center of each. for even cooking and so the burgers stay even throughout. you won`t get the fat center with this method.
- 4 shape patties to desired thickness.
- 5 chill burgers for 1 hour to firm up.
- 6 grill or broil 4-6 inches from heat source or.
- 7 place in lightly oiled skillet.
- 8 cook 3-5 minutes per side.
- 9 serve rare to medium-rare.
- 10 cooking times vary based on cooking temperature and thickness of meat.
- 11 optional cheese choices a nice cheddar or monterey jack cheese.
